Do I need a special sewing machine for upholstery or can I start with my own machine? Can I get one used.
You don’t need anything super special, but domestic machines made with plastic parts can not hold up long with upholstery fabrics and threads. I always recommend finding an old all-metal electric machine. If you can find a walking foot, bonus! It doesn’t have to be industrial though, and you can find a lot of these antique machines free or super cheap on marketplace.
